Transaction 8e9161678572918130afbfb65ae59173ba94fc1fe12a3f0bf1b0fd3d34d805c2
1 Input
1 Output
-
8e9161678572918130afbfb65ae59173ba94fc1fe12a3f0bf1b0fd3d34d805c2:0
- value
- 472400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66e8da7aa7f780242ea084a0b847d1dda694de93 OP_EQUAL
- address
- 3B59o3tnQ6BXw8XS7AnGj7EQjj57YRbi2P